Human Resources Development Agency of Papua holds Administrator Leadership Training (PKA) and Supervisory Leadership Training (PKP)
A total of 80 State Civil Apparatus (ASN) in the environment of provincial and district governments in Papua participated in Administrator Leadership Training (PKA) and Supervisory Leadership Training (PKP).
The training that took place in the hall of the Human Resources Development Agency (BPSDM) office, Kotaraja, Jayapura was officially opened by Assistant I Regional Secretariat of Papua Province, Doren Wakerkwa, SH accompanied by the head of Human Resources Development Agency Papua, Aryoko AF Rumaropen, M.Eng, this week.
Assistant I Doren Wakerkwa said that the training aims to increase the capacity of the State Civil Apparatus in supervision and administrators. "This training is an effort to encourage and improve the ability of State Civil Apparatus in innovating in serving the community and carrying out basic tasks as a state apparatus," he said.
Wakerkwa explained that by the training, they can create a more efficient work system in responding and serving quickly the needs of the community. "We hope this training can encourage State Civil Apparatus in Papua to improve performance and service to the community. In the past, the work system was not compatible with the current conditions, they can innovate in their respective offices to improve services."
In the same place the head of Human Resources Development Agency Papua, Aryoko Rumaropen, SP, M.Eng, said this training is a process for State Civil Apparatus in pursuing a career as a public servant. Therefore, the training is adjusted to the career level and competence of State Civil Apparatus.
"The career of the employee who occupies the position begins from the training process. And that has to be taken from basic training.
The career management is also adjusted to the competence of the State Civil Apparatus," he said.
Rumaropen suggested that in accordance with the new provisions, the current career level process is different from previous times. In the past, career-level training was called Leadership Training but now changed to Leadership Training of Apparatus in the field of administration and Leadership Training of Apparatus for the Supervisory level.
"The process is step by step. The training is held under new regulation. If it used to be called Leadership Training then it has now changed to The Training of Apparatus Leadership in the Field of Administration and Training of Personnel Leadership at the supervisory level, namely the level at the Structural Echelon III and IV," said Rumaropen.
On this occasion, Aryoko also asked the participants to follow the training well so that when returning to their respective places of duty, they can create new innovations in terms of work, especially in human resources development services.
